摘要本次研究是对云计算服务的一个具体实现,是对小规模云节点协同工作问题的一次探究,是对一个具有初步规模的云计算服务的一次优化。
这个云服务针对的案例则是以近年来尤为流行的ACM/ICPC国际大学生程序设计竞赛为背景,设计的一个在线判题系统的客户端。
这个判题系统可以在大量用户进行比赛的过程中,使用选手机器的闲置资源进行判题,以缓解服务器的压力。从而实现网络计算、分布式计算以及并行计算合并起来的云服务体系。
在学习和总结前人工作的基础上,本次研究的工作内容包括以下几点:64925
1.分析当前环境背景下的云计算资源调度现状,梳理云计算的概念,分类、应用、关键技术以及分布式处理框架技术。
2.掌握现有实例(即分布式判题系统)中所使用各项技术,构建并完善现有实例中的缺陷。
3.针对当前实例中存在的问题进行优化,包括调整整个服务上层所提供的接口,优化各模块之间通信所存在的冗余,以及对使用频率较高的数据进行缓存和加密解密处理等。
毕业论文关键词 云计算 资源分配 优化 调度算法
毕业设计说明书(论文)外文摘要
Title : research of some problems to cloud nodes working together
Abstract This study is a concrete implementation of cloud computing service , is an exploratory of small-scale cloud nodes work together , is an optimization of a cloud computing services with preliminary scale .
The case for cloud services is based on the International Collegiate Programming Contest which is particularly popular in recent years. The design is an online judge system , we call it OJ for short.
The OJ can enable a number of users to compete using the cilent computers' idle resources to judge and feedback so that ease the pressure on the server. In order to achieve network computing, distributed computing and parallel computing combined cloud service system.
On the basis of the previous work ,this study include the following ponints:
1.Analyzing the deployment and allocation conditons in current background ,Stating the concept , kinds , application and core tech which emphasized the distributing process framework technologies.
2. Grasp the technology of the existing instance , build and improve the existing instance defects.
3.A problem in this instance, a series of optimization, including the entire adjustment services are provided on the upper interface, to optimize the communication between the various modules, redundant information, the use of high frequency data to be cached and encrypted decryption processing. and so on
Keywords: Cloud computing , Resource allocation , Optimization ,
Scheduling algorithm
目 录
1 引言 1
1.1 云计算定义 1
1.2 云计算的特征 2
2 技术模型与研究背景 3
2.1 云计算模型 3
2.2 负载均衡技术 5
2.3 虚拟化技术 6
2.4 实际应用背景 7
3 架构解析 云节点协同工作若干问题的研究:http://www.youerw.com/jisuanji/lunwen_72345.html